Arrived in Casablanca

I arrived in Casablanca on Friday. Royal Air Maroc gives great service. When I left the ladies room in Mohammed V Airport, I reeked of smoke. The people are chain smokers here. It’s a good thing they are not allowed to smoke on the plane!

The 1940s movie classic ‘Casablanca’ with Humprey Bogart was filmed here. One of my goals was to see the newly refurbished Rick’s Bar where many scenes were filmed. They say this bar/restaurant is very popular with the tourists.
Rick's Cafe

I stayed at Hotel Azur. It was nice and comfortable though not a four or five star. But since it was free, courtesy of Royal Air Maroc, it was fine with me. The transport to and from the hotel plus lunch were also free. Can’t beat that!
I found a driver named Moustapha who gave a great 2 hour tour. It included the neighborhood of the Morrocan ‘mafia’ juxtaposed to the very poor neighbor neighborhood in Medina.
